Collaboration with Free Range Brewing
Crafted with local barley malt and a pinch of wheat malt. Fermented cool with our preferred saison yeast blend. Conditioned on a delicate amount of chamomile flowers and aged hops. Circulated through sight glasses out in the sun for an experimental “skunking” affect.

Canned on date smudged on the bottom rim of the can. Poured into a Samuel Adams Perfect Pint.
A: Slightly hazy straw yellow with short-lived small white head with no lacing.
S: Sharp vegetal and burnt paper aroma with light fruit esters.
T: Flavor is also just as sharp although there are floral esters and herbal floral component as well. Strong clashing flavors with tea like heavy tannins and stable tobacco and floral character combined with earthy yeast notes.
M: Dry dry dry with light body but undercarbonated, probably due to the light body to prevent it from being too biting and watery.
O: I did not like this beer as the floral chamomile and sharp tannins of what I presume are the aged hops clash strongly and unpleasantly.

CANNED ON 9/14/18
Lightly hazed yellow gold with a creamy white head. Smells of oatmeal, hay, and subtle earthy flowers with a little rustic funk to it - not as "dirty" as some other FF farmhouse beers I've experienced. Very similar flavor - nice soft Belgian yeast profile, a little herbal dankness on the finish. Light and pretty crisp - could use just a bit more carbonation, but it's still damn refreshing. No Bretty funk or high acidity or overwhelming yeast esters...just a delicious, simple Saison. I like this one a lot!
